Wearable-Triggered Digital Safety Net for Real-Time Monitoring & Intervention in Leptomeningeal Metastasis

Conditions: Leptomeningeal Metastasis

Sex: All
Ages: 18 Years – N/A
Healthy volunteers: No
Phase: NA
Enrollment: 48
Sponsor: Case Comprehensive Cancer Center

Location: Cleveland Clinic, Case Comprehensive Cancer Center Cleveland Ohio

Summary

This research study is for participants diagnosed with leptomeningeal metastasis disease (LMM), a condition where cancer has spread to the fluid and membranes surround the brain and spinal cord. The purpose of this study is to find out whether a consumer Smartwatch can continuously monitor the participant's health and detect early signs of neurological decline and whether sending an automatic alert to the participant's doctor when a change is detected can help reduce the number of participant hospitalizations.

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ria: * Participants must have leptomeningeal metastasis (LMM) diagnosed per clinical, imaging, and/or CSF/cytology criteria (cytology, flow cytometry, or circulating tumor DNA), arising from any solid or hematologic tumor primary. * Participants must be undergoing active anti-cancer therapy (systemic, intrathecal, and/or radiation) or active surveillance for LMM. * Age ≥18 years at the time of study enrollment. Because no safety or dosing data are available for wearable monitoring studies in children with LMM, participants under 18 years of age are excluded. * Karnofsky Performance Status (KPS) ≥50 at time of study enrollment \[See Appendix I\], to ensure feasibility of wearing the device for ≥10 hours/day. * Participants must have access to a compatible smartphone: * iPhone running iOS 16 or higher and willingness to wear Apple Watch ≥10 hours/day; OR * Android smartphone compatible with the study application and willingness to wear Samsung Galaxy Watch ≥10 hours/day. * Ability to provide informed consent (or a legally authorized representative \[LAR\] is available and willing to provide consent on the participant's behalf, if appropriate).
